What Is Tarta de Cebolla y Queso?

Tarta de Cebolla y Queso is a traditional Argentine savory pie made with a buttery pastry crust filled with slow-cooked onions, melted cheese, eggs, cream, and seasonings. The filling is baked until rich, creamy, and lightly golden, creating a perfect balance between the sweetness of onions and the savory flavor of cheese.

Unlike a French quiche, this South American favorite usually features a thicker crust and a heartier filling, making it a satisfying meal on its own.

Traditional ingredients often include:

  • Sweet onions
  • Mozzarella cheese
  • Provolone or Parmesan cheese
  • Eggs
  • Heavy cream or milk
  • Butter
  • Olive oil
  • Salt
  • Black pepper
  • Nutmeg (optional)
  • Fresh parsley
  • Flaky pie crust

The result is a comforting dish with a creamy texture, crispy crust, and irresistible aroma.

Ingredients That Make an Authentic Tarta de Cebolla y Queso

Every ingredient contributes to the signature taste of this beloved dish.

Caramelized Onions

The onions should be slowly cooked until soft and naturally sweet without burning.

High-Quality Cheese

Traditional recipes commonly include:

  • Mozzarella
  • Provolone
  • Parmesan
  • Reggianito (Argentine hard cheese)

The combination creates a creamy yet flavorful filling.

Fresh Eggs and Cream

Eggs and cream bind the filling together while giving it a smooth texture.

Buttery Pastry

A flaky, golden crust is essential for authentic Tarta de Cebolla y Queso.

Simple Seasonings

Most recipes rely on:

  • Salt
  • Black pepper
  • Nutmeg
  • Fresh herbs

These ingredients enhance the filling without overpowering it.

Frequently Asked Questions About Tarta de Cebolla y Queso

Is Tarta de Cebolla y Queso vegetarian?

Yes. Traditional recipes typically contain no meat, making it a popular vegetarian dish. However, always check with the restaurant for any recipe variations.

What type of cheese is best?

The most common choices include mozzarella, provolone, Parmesan, and Reggianito, though some restaurants use local cheese blends.

Can it be eaten cold?

Yes. Many people enjoy it warm or at room temperature, making it a convenient option for picnics and packed lunches.

Can I freeze it?

Yes. It freezes well when wrapped properly. Reheat in the oven for the best texture and flavor.

Is it similar to quiche?

While both dishes feature eggs and dairy, Tarta de Cebolla y Queso typically has a thicker pastry crust, more onions, and a distinctly South American flavor profile.
